What are the VIRTUS® programs?
The United States Conference of Catholic Bishops' Charter for the Protection of Children and Young People requires that each employee and/or volunteer within every parish be trained and screened if they have contact with or minister to children. The program in the Archdiocese of Chicago is called VIRTUS or Protecting God's Children for Adults.

The workshop educates clergy, staff and volunteers who work with children, about the ways to create safe environments for children. The workshop includes videos and facilitated discussions that focus on the prevention of abuse and the protection of children.
Who Should Attend the Workshop?
All those who interact and are involved in ministry, both as paid employees and as volunteers working with children in our parish, will be trained to assure a safe, healthy and secure environment for our children. Background screening will be conducted for each individual as a component of application to serve in ministry. Though this program might be viewed as an additional burden and time consuming, it is essential for the welfare and safety of our children.
